Choose Your Transport Wisely**:
Flight**: The quickest option, with direct flights from Cairo to Aqaba taking about 1.5 hours. Book in advance to secure the best fares.
Bus**: A budget-friendly option, but expect a longer journey (approximately 10-12 hours). Check companies like GoBus for schedules and online booking.
Car**: If you prefer flexibility, driving offers scenic views. The route via the Nuweiba-Aqaba ferry can be picturesque but check ferry schedules in advance.
Train**: Limited connectivity; usually not the most practical choice for this route.
Plan for Border Crossings**:
If traveling by land, prepare for the Taba border crossing into Israel, then proceed to Aqaba. Have your passport ready, and check visa requirements. Expect waiting times; early morning crossings may be less crowded.
Timing is Key**:
Regardless of your mode of transport, aim to travel during weekdays to avoid weekend crowds, especially at border crossings. Consider early morning departures for flights and buses to maximize your time in Aqaba.
Luggage Considerations**:
For flights, check baggage allowances and pack essentials in carry-ons. If traveling by bus or car, ensure your luggage is secure and easy to manage during stops, especially at borders.
Stay Connected**:
Purchase a local SIM card or international roaming plan for mobile data, especially useful for navigation and last-minute bookings. Wi-Fi is often available at hotels and some public spaces in Aqaba.
